Avalanche Activity

Moist snow slides and avalanches are possible in isolated cases.

As the moisture increases individual mostly small wet snow slides and avalanches are possible. Above approximately 1900 m and in gullies and bowls the danger of moist and wet avalanches is a little higher. This applies in particular on sunny slopes.

Snowpack Structure

The snowpack remains quite favourable. Below approximately 1600 m hardly any snow is lying. The fresh and older wind slabs are to be found especially in gullies and bowls and at high altitudes. Slow warming: These weather conditions will give rise to gradual moistening of the snowpack in particular on sunny slopes.
